The primary component of any steel frame barn is the steel itself. The price of steel fluctuates based on market conditions; thus, it’s essential to consider this variability when budgeting for your barn. Additionally, while steel barns typically require less maintenance than wooden structures, the labor costs for assembly can be substantial, particularly if you're hiring a contractor. The complexity of the design, local labor rates, and any necessary permits also contribute to the final costs.
From a construction standpoint, factory metal buildings offer significant time and cost savings. Traditional construction methods can be time-consuming and labor-intensive, often leading to delays and increased expenses. In contrast, pre-engineered metal buildings are prefabricated, allowing for rapid assembly on-site. This efficiency reduces labor costs and minimizes disruption to ongoing operations. The speed of construction also means that businesses can occupy their new facilities sooner, enabling them to capitalize on opportunities without unnecessary delays.

5. Site Preparation and Additional Costs Preparing the site for a prefab steel building can include excavation, laying foundation, and ensuring proper drainage. These factors can significantly influence the overall cost per square foot. Furthermore, there may be additional expenses such as utilities, landscaping, and interior finish work that should be anticipated when budgeting.

Moreover, metal garage buildings often require significantly less maintenance than their wooden counterparts. While wooden garages may need regular painting, sealing, or repairs due to wear and tear, metal buildings are typically coated with protective finishes that prevent rust and corrosion. This not only translates to cost savings for owners in terms of upkeep but also means that they can spend more time enjoying their garage rather than maintaining it.
